In New Jersey, the standard base pay range for a Full-Time role is $70,000 - $102,000 annually with an opportunity to earn more. Part-Time and FOX Flex (PRN) will be pro-rated.
Candidates must possess a valid Physical Therapy license in the state(s) of practice or be eligible to apply, along with a degree from an accredited physical therapy program. Basic computer literacy skills and current CPR certification are also required.
